Solana's real-world asset (RWA) ecosystem is approaching $1.​5 billion in total value locked as institutional adoption of tokenization accelerates.​

Key Developments:

  • Tokenized treasuries and fractional real estate are attracting institutional capital
  • Solana's technical advantages (speed and low transaction costs) are enabling broader accessibility
  • The growth reflects a broader trend toward mainstream tokenization in 2026

Market Context: While the overall RWA market has grown, adoption remains concentrated in specific sectors:

  • Private credit dominates with $15.​5B in active loans
  • Tokenized treasuries account for $7.​4B (up 500% year-over-year)
  • Gold tokenization shows $2.​1B in proven success

The infrastructure supporting these assets continues to evolve, with stablecoin issuers building dedicated settlement layers and new solutions emerging for reserve verification and cross-chain attestation.​

Bitbond Launches Self-Serve Platform for Regulated Token Offerings

Bitbond has opened its Offering Manager platform to the public, allowing companies to launch regulated token offerings without extensive technical overhead. The platform supports three core functions: - **Configure**: Set pricing, investment caps, and custom branding - **Onboard**: Integrated KYC/AML compliance through white-label investor portals - **Collect**: Accept payments via credit cards, stablecoins, and wire transfers The system supports multiple asset types including equity tokens, real estate, and digital bonds. It operates across Ethereum, Solana, and Stellar networks. Bitbond reports the infrastructure has already powered over 300 token offerings. Token Tool Launches 60-Second MCP Install for Claude Desktop and IDEs

**Quick Setup Process** Token Tool now offers a streamlined installation through Model Context Protocol (MCP) that takes just 60 seconds. Users can install via a single command: `npx -y token-tool-mcp` **Platform Compatibility** - Works with Claude Desktop - Integrates with Cursor - Compatible with VS Code The tool maintains its $299/token pricing for mainnet deployments, matching the existing web UI cost. One-click installation links are available in the project's README documentation. **What This Means** Developers can now access Token Tool's ERC20, ERC1400, and NFT deployment capabilities directly within their development environments, streamlining the token creation workflow without switching between applications.

馃 TokenTool Launches First MCP Server for AI-Powered Token Compliance

**TokenTool has released the first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for compliant token issuance**, enabling AI agents like Claude to deploy and manage tokens with built-in compliance features. **Key capabilities:** - 17 tools covering full token lifecycle: deploy, mint, burn, pause, transfer, and query - Whitelist and blacklist management for regulatory compliance - CertiK-audited smart contracts - Support for 10 blockchain networks plus testnets - Deployment in approximately 30 seconds via AI prompts **Track record:** TokenTool has powered over 8,300 real-world token deployments since 2020, serving enterprises and DAOs across 50+ countries. The MCP server uses the same audited infrastructure that has been battle-tested in production. The integration allows users to manage compliance operations directly through conversational AI, moving beyond simple deployment to include ongoing token administration and regulatory controls.
